Latest Patents

Volland's latest patents include groundbreaking methods for preparing higher molecular weight polyisobutylene. The first patent details a process for preparing isobutene homopolymers, focusing on achieving a weight-average molecular weight ranging from 75,000 to 10,000,000 through a polymerization process utilizing isobutene. His second patent presents an innovative method for producing polyisobutene, where isobutene droplets are polymerized in the presence of an inert diluent and a halogen-containing Lewis acid catalyst. This unique approach enhances the efficiency and quality of polyisobutene production.
